//// Tables.
import React from "react";
import PropTypes from 'prop-types';
class DefaultWrapper {
constructor(data) {
this.data = data;
this.get = this.get.bind(this);
}
get(fieldName) {
return this.data[fieldName];
}
}
function defaultWrapper(data) {
return new DefaultWrapper(data);
}
export class Table extends React.Component {
// className
// caption
// columns : {name: [title, order]}
// data: [objects with expected column names]
// wrapper: (optional) function to use to wrap one data entry into an object before accessing fields.
// Must return an instance with a method get(name).
// If provided: wrapper(data_entry).get(field_name)
// else: data_entry[field_name]
constructor(props) {
super(props);
if (!this.props.wrapper)
this.props.wrapper = defaultWrapper;
}
static getHeader(columns) {
const header = [];
for (let entry of Object.entries(columns)) {
const name = entry[0];
const title = entry[1][0];
const order = entry[1][1];
header.push([order, name, title]);
}
header.sort((a, b) => {
let t = a[0] - b[0];
if (t === 0)
t = a[1].localeCompare(b[1]);
if (t === 0)
t = a[2].localeCompare(b[2]);
return t;
});
return header;
}
static getHeaderLine(header) {
return (
<thead className={'thead-light'}>
<tr>{header.map((column, colIndex) => <th key={colIndex}>{column[2]}</th>)}</tr>
</thead>
);
}
static getBodyRow(header, row, rowIndex, wrapper) {
const wrapped = wrapper(row);
return (<tr key={rowIndex}>
{header.map((headerColumn, colIndex) => <td className={'align-middle'}
key={colIndex}>{wrapped.get(headerColumn[1])}</td>)}
</tr>);
}
static getBodyLines(header, data, wrapper) {
return (<tbody>{data.map((row, rowIndex) => Table.getBodyRow(header, row, rowIndex, wrapper))}</tbody>);
}
render() {
const header = Table.getHeader(this.props.columns);
return (
<div className={'table-responsive'}>
<table className={this.props.className}>
<caption>{this.props.caption} ({this.props.data.length})</caption>
{Table.getHeaderLine(header)}
{Table.getBodyLines(header, this.props.data, this.props.wrapper)}
</table>
</div>
);
}
}
Table.propTypes = {
wrapper: PropTypes.func,
columns: PropTypes.object,
className: PropTypes.string,
caption: PropTypes.string,
data: PropTypes.array
};
